American actor and writer John Paul Reynolds (born August 5,1991) works in both fields. He gained notoriety for both his appearances on Stranger Things (2016–2022) and his starring part in the television series Search Party (2016–2022).

Early life and education
In Madison, Wisconsin, on August 5, 1991 (age: 31 as of 2023) John Reynolds was born. He spent his formative years in Madison, where he was raised.
Reynolds attended Madison High School in Madison, Wisconsin, a four-year comprehensive high school. He relocated to Chicago, Illinois, after finishing high school to attend the IO Training Centre for long-form improvisation training.

Career
In the comedy “Party Time Party Time,” in which he played Lewk, he made his acting debut in 2013. He portrayed Robby, one of the lead characters in the 2018 comedy “A Maine Movie,” and he also made an appearance in the thriller/mystery short “Formaldehyde.”
In the 2014 comedy “The Chris Gethard Show: Public Access,” he made his acting debut as Todd Watch. Since then, he has made multiple guest appearances on various television programmes, notably the comedy “We Have to Move.” John played two distinct characters in four episodes of the comedy “The Special Without Brett Davis” in 2015.

Then he appeared in the comedy “Thanksgiving” as Chad Morgan. In the 2019 romantic comedy “Four Weddings and a Funeral,” which was based on the hugely successful movie of the same name, he plays Duffy, one of the main characters. The 2020 short animated comedy “Wild Life” included John’s debut as Glenn.
He’s been portraying Drew Gardner in the crime comedy-drama “Search Party” since 2021. The sci-fi action comedy “Save Yourselves” from 2020 may have caught John’s attention the most.
In the drama “Cowboys” and the suspenseful thriller “Horse Girl,” both released in 2020, John has his most recent film roles.
Writing
Three of John’s works have been released. In 2015, he wrote the comedy series “The Special Without Brett Davis,” an episode titled “The Perception Society.” He also penned the short comedies “Women Are Mean” in 2018 and “To the Moon” in 2019.
